3. Take Short Breaks
Uninterrupted work causes burnout to develop. Regular breaks involving the Pomodoro method allow workers to work for 25 minutes, followed by a 5-minute pause to refresh their mindset. Brief rest periods help people maintain their concentration and minimise tiredness levels.
Tip: Stand up, stretch, or take a quick walk to reset your mind.
4. Limit Distractions
Apart from social media and unnecessary notifications, and multitasking, people experience decreased productivity. Establish focused work areas while defining schedules for checking both phones and social media applications.
Actionable Tip: Use “Do Not Disturb” mode during work hours.

6. Eat Healthy and Stay Hydrated
Your brain needs fuel to perform. A balanced diet and proper hydration can prevent sluggishness and keep you mentally sharp.
Healthy Habit Tip: Avoid heavy meals during work hours and keep a water bottle nearby.
7. Reflect and Plan Tomorrow
At the end of the day, take 10 minutes to reflect on what you achieved and what needs improvement. This helps you plan a better tomorrow.
Bonus Tip: Write down tomorrow’s tasks before sleeping—it helps reduce anxiety and gives you a sense of control.
